List of Class III Roads
Dear Rotherham Metropolitan Borough Council,
This request is being made under the Freedom of Information Act 2000. I would like to request a list of roads and their numbers within your remit - including those that are generally not signposted - in addition to the standard M, A and B roads. These "Class III" and unclassified roads tend to go by the designations C, D or U, although the exact details vary by area and may differ from any or all of these. From information I already have, Sheffield has numbered C roads - the numbering system seems to be common across South Yorkshire.
A map detailing these roads would be appreciated but is not necessary for you to fulfil your obligation. A list of roads and their numbers in spreadsheet format is preferable, however the basic data in list format will be adequate if a spreadsheet is unavailable.
